The Tailoring Strategies Explained



The art of tailoring depends on a range of methods that change textile right into well-fitted garments. Central to this process is pattern drafting, where a tailor creates templates based on the client's measurements and preferred style. This preliminary action makes certain that the garment will certainly fit the user effectively before any kind of reducing occurs.


Once patterns are established, reducing techniques come into play. Precision is vital as inaccuracies can result in misfitting garments. Tailors typically use different cutting approaches, such as single-layer reducing for complex layouts and multiple-layer cutting for efficiency on typical patterns.

Seaming strategies, consisting of flat-felled joints and French seams, improve the garment's toughness and aesthetic allure. Tailors additionally use techniques such as interfacing and padding to provide structure and shape to particular areas, like collars and visit this site right here shoulders.


Lastly, ending up methods, consisting of hemming and edge finishing, ensure the garment's longevity while providing a polished look. Together, these strategies create the foundation of reliable customizing, resulting in splendid, tailor-made apparel.

Preserving Your Tailored Wardrobe



Constantly comply with the treatment label instructions, which might advise completely dry cleaning for fragile fabrics or device cleaning for more resilient products. Stay clear of frequent laundering, as this can put on down the fabric and change the garment's form.


Storage space is just as crucial; usage padded hangers for jackets and layers to keep shoulder framework, and store pants folded up neatly or hung to avoid creasing. Shield garments from direct sunlight, which can discolor shades and damage fibers.




Furthermore, routine evaluations for small repair services can stop bigger problems. Inspect for loose switches, tearing joints, or indicators of moth damages, addressing these issues quickly to maintain the garment's integrity.


Lastly, consider seasonal turning. Wearing tailored items in small amounts allows textiles to recuperate, prolonging their life expectancy.
